Evaluation of Integrated Cardiac Imaging for the Detection and Characterization of Ischemic Heart Disease

Fondazione C.N.R./Regione Toscana "G. Monasterio", Pisa, Italy·interventional·Posted Sep 17, 2009·Updated Jul 21, 2014

In Brief

A Phase 4 clinical trial evaluating Non invasive cardiac imaging for Ischemic Heart Disease. Completed, enrolled 697 participants across 16 sites in 9 countries.

Detailed Summary

Main purpose of the study: To comparatively assess the diagnostic performance of non invasive anatomical and functional imaging modalities to detect significant obstructive coronary artery disease as demonstrated at invasive coronary angiography and functional evaluation of coronary lesions (fractional flow reserve).

Interventions

Non invasive cardiac imagingother

Non invasive cardiac imaging consists of CTCA combined with one Stress Imaging Test
